The oldest yew tree in the world is located in a small churchyard of St. Dygain's Church in Llangernyw village, north Wales. It is about 4000 years old.

The worlds oldest tree is... A Bristlecone pine tree found in California, and it is 4,600 years old.The title for the world's oldest tree could go to several trees.One of the contenders is believed to be a Palmer's oak (Quercus palmeri) in California, estimated at around 13,000 years old.
